New Principal Named at Plainfield North

Plainfield North Assistant Principal Ross Draper will take over as principal July 1.

PLAINFIELD, IL — Current Plainfield North High School Assistant Principal Ross Draper will take over as the school’s principal starting July 1, 2016.

Draper came to District 202 in 2009 as an assistant principal at PNHS. He will replace Ray Epperson who will take on a new administrative role within the district next year.

Draper started his education career in 1998, serving three years as a physical education teacher at Long Beach Elementary School in Oswego School District 308.

From 2001-05 he worked as the Physical Education/Health/Drivers Education department chair at Oswego East High School, then as Dean of Students there from 2005-08.

He served one year as Dean of Students at West Aurora High School before coming to District 202 in 2009.

“As an internal candidate, Mr. Draper showed throughout the search process that he has the confidence of the selection committees,” said District 202 Superintendent of Schools Dr. Lane Abrell.

“In his time at Plainfield North he has shown his strong communication skills, loyalty and hard work, which have allowed him to develop insights to the needs of the building, population, and community,” Abrell said. “We welcome Mr. Draper to our building principal team and look forward to his contributions.”

Draper thanked Abrell and the Board of Education for their decision.

“It has been a professional goal of mine to lead a building. I don’t think there is a better scenario to start as a principal than leading a building where I have been for the last seven years,” Draper said. ”I can’t say enough positive things about the amazing staff and students at North. I look forward to leading, supporting, and motivating them to reach their full potential,” he said.
